1) Daily self-tuning capability for any change in mods, temp, humidity, octane, and/or boost.
2) Inexpensive
3a) Does not touch the factory ECU, so it cannot be detected by the dealer in any
3b) Can be uninstalled/reinstalled within minutes
4) Does not require removal and mailing of the ECU
Con's
1) Requires splicing/soldering of S-AFC wires to either the ECU wires or a Fields harness - *NEW* The S-AFC can be bought pre-spliced to a harness now
2) Only works by "fooling" the ECU into thinking more or less air is flowing, thus artificially affecting the AFRs.
3) Only affects timing INDIRECTLY through the AFRs and knock. Only base timing maps can be used thusly
4) Due to the factory ECU tune that causes Evos to run lean before 5000 rpm, timing is near 0 at peak torque, which causes torque numbers to be noticeably lower. To get the AFRs under 12 from 3500-5000, you have to add a little fuel, which only affects timing NEGATIVELY
